RBI approves merger of BOR with ICICI
Bank of Rajasthan finally ceases to exist. As of 13 August, all its branches will be called ICICI Bank. This is after the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) today gave its sanction to the amalgamation, reports CNBC-TV18’s Latha Venkatesh.

"All branches of Bank of Rajasthan will function as branches of ICICI Bank with effect from August 13, 2010," RBI said in statement.
In May, after both the banks agreed for the amalgamation and getting the shareholders' approval, they moved the RBI on June 25 for approval of the scheme of merger.
Post regulatory approvals, this would be the third acquisition by ICICI Bank. It acquired Bank of Madura way back in 2001 and Maharashtra-based Sangli Bank was amalgamated with itself in 2007.
